The Shed BBQ wins national award
The Shed is a well-known barbecue and blues joint, but the South Mississippi restaurant is far from singing the blues.
“The Shed platter, so all seven meats all in one. Pretty much killed it.” Michael George is more than 900 miles away from his home in Chicago.
The Shed has been featured on national TV shows and has landed a number of world championship awards for their famous barbecue during the past 18 years they’ve been in business. The Shed serves up a little something for every type of palate, even those of the four legged variety as evidenced by Michael George’s traveling companion.
So it should come as no surprise that the Shed BBQ and Blues Joint has been named the best BBQ in the state of Mississippi by the Food Network. Owner Brad Orrison said, “Getting an accomplishment like this is not only great for us, but also for everybody that works here, and our customers and also our community. You know, the more tourists we have, the better off we all are, right?”
If being named best BBQ in Mississippi wasn’t enough, Southern Living Magazine ranked the Shed number one on their Great American Bucket List, but what makes this South Mississippi treasure standout among others? “I think what makes the Shed so special is it’s such a genuine place.”
